"Need" is a relative term, but objectively it's a stretch to say you need this set if you already have the albums on CD. Personally, I love it.

The sound of the remasters on the box set is excellent to my ears, not compressed or EQ-juiced like the 1999 REMASTERED EDITION reissues. The 2-disc singles set includes all the b-sides, edits and remixes (although it forgoes the single version of Over You that fades before the segue into 8 Miles High).

I love the simplicity of the packaging; no book with an historic essay and photos and all that; just the albums in well-made gatefold, glossy cardboard sleeves with some photo session outtakes inside those that weren't originally gatefold.

I'm sure some people prefer the sound of the 1999 versions of the albums so you might try borrowing a copy or getting a CDR of an album or two from the box before deciding if you well and truly need it. They do sound quite different... you'll know if it's to your audio tastes or not.
